So Why Electronic Shelf Labels?

1. Dynamic Pricing and Promotions

  • Real-Time Price Updates: ESLs allow retailers to update prices instantly across all stores or specific locations, enabling dynamic pricing strategies based on demand, competition, or inventory levels.

  • Promotional Flexibility: Retailers can quickly launch and manage promotions, flash sales, or discounts without the need for manual price changes, ensuring consistency and reducing errors.

2. Improved Operational Efficiency

  • Reduced Labor Costs: Automating price changes eliminates the need for staff to manually replace paper labels, saving time and labor costs.

  • Streamlined Inventory Management: ESLs can integrate with inventory systems to display stock levels, reducing out-of-stock situations and improving restocking processes.

  • Error Reduction: Automated updates minimize human errors in pricing, ensuring accurate and consistent pricing across the store.

3. Enhanced Customer Experience

  • Accurate Pricing: Customers are less likely to encounter discrepancies between shelf prices and checkout prices, improving trust and satisfaction.

  • Product Information: ESLs can display detailed product information, such as ingredients, nutritional facts, or reviews, helping customers make informed decisions.

  • Personalized Offers: ESLs can be linked to customer loyalty programs or mobile apps to display personalized discounts or recommendations.

4. Sustainability and Cost Savings

  • Reduced Paper Waste: ESLs eliminate the need for paper labels, reducing waste and contributing to sustainability goals.

  • Long-Term Cost Savings: While the initial investment in ESLs may be high, the long-term savings from reduced labor, printing, and errors can outweigh the costs.

5. Data-Driven Insights

  • Sales Analytics: ESLs can collect data on customer interactions, such as time spent viewing products or price sensitivity, providing valuable insights for optimizing pricing and marketing strategies.

  • A/B Testing: Retailers can test different pricing strategies or product placements in real-time to determine what works best.

6. Improved Compliance and Accuracy

  • Regulatory Compliance: ESLs ensure that pricing and labeling comply with local regulations, such as displaying taxes or unit pricing accurately.

  • Consistency Across Locations: Centralized control of ESLs ensures that pricing and promotions are consistent across multiple store locations.

7. Enhanced Omnichannel Integration

  • Seamless Online and In-Store Experience: ESLs can sync with e-commerce platforms, ensuring that in-store prices match online prices, creating a cohesive omnichannel experience.

  • Click-and-Collect Support: ESLs can highlight products available for click-and-collect services, improving the efficiency of online order fulfillment.

8. Competitive Advantage

  • Agility in Pricing: Retailers can respond quickly to market changes or competitor pricing, maintaining a competitive edge.

  • Innovative Shopping Experience: ESLs can enhance the in-store experience with features like QR codes for additional product information or mobile app integration, attracting tech-savvy customers.

9. Space Optimization

  • Flexible Layouts: ESLs make it easier to rearrange store layouts or update product placements without the hassle of relabeling, allowing for more efficient use of space.

10. Employee Productivity

  • Focus on Customer Service: With fewer manual tasks, employees can focus more on assisting customers, improving overall service quality.

  • Training Efficiency: ESLs reduce the need for extensive training on price changes, allowing staff to focus on other aspects of their roles.
